Great beach location as this restaurant sits on its own pier in condo land. The wind can be pretty strong on the pier and the food is served in baskets (besides the ribs) instead of on heavy plates. Family ordered sandwiches and all gave thumbs up. I ordered the famous ribs (which came in a sand castle bucket you get to keep) and was very happy with my choice. Drinks were the normal Fat Tuesday drinks. Great tasting, strong and a little pricey. We ordered the pineapple Willy and 190 octane. Both packed a punch and both would be ordered again. Timing your dining is very important at this place. In the evening you can easily expect to wait an hour or so more. Recommend trying to go in between lunch and the dinner rush if you want to try it out. Although if you want to be in the midst of the chaos hit the place when night falls for a great time. Parking comes at a premium as this place is neatled in between several condos. Finding a spot in the smallish parking lot requires some luck. Otherwise you are hunting for a spot on the street down the road.
